Administration of the State and the economic and social policy of the community
ISIC v4.0 Code: 841
About administration of the state and the economic and social policy of the community
isic code 841 covers the administration of the state and the economic and social policy of the community. This industry is a critical component of the public sector, responsible for the governance, regulation, and implementation of policies that shape the economic and social landscape of a country or region. As a central pillar of the government, this industry plays a vital role in ensuring the efficient and equitable distribution of resources, the provision of public services, and the overall well-being of the population.
Production process
The main production techniques used in this industry involve the development and implementation of policies, regulations, and administrative procedures. This includes the drafting of legislation, the formulation of strategic plans, the allocation of budgets, the coordination of government agencies, and the monitoring and evaluation of policy outcomes. These processes often involve extensive research, stakeholder engagement, and decision-making processes to ensure that the policies and programs are aligned with the needs and priorities of the community.
Production inputs
The key inputs required for this industry include a skilled and knowledgeable workforce, such as policy analysts, public administrators, and elected officials. Additionally, this industry relies on access to data, information, and research to inform policy decisions, as well as financial resources to fund government operations and public programs. Infrastructure, such as government buildings, information technology systems, and communication networks, are also essential inputs for the effective administration of the state and the implementation of economic and social policies.
Production outputs
The main outputs of this industry are the policies, regulations, and administrative decisions that shape the economic and social landscape of a country or region. These outputs can have far-reaching impacts on various 842 Provision of services to the community as a whole, 843 Compulsory social security activities, and 851 Education, among other industries. The administration of the state and the economic and social policy of the community also generates a range of public services, such as healthcare, education, infrastructure development, and social welfare programs, which are essential for the well-being and development of the population.
